This article applies to Bowdoin faculty, staff, and students who want to record a pronunciation of their name for use in Canvas and the Bowdoin directory.

  • Canvas at canvas.bowdoin.edu
  • A NameCoach recording is called a NameBadge. Once recorded, it populates the Bowdoin directory pages and any Canvas courses you are enrolled in.

Resolution

NameCoach lets you record a pronunciation of your name from within your Canvas user account settings. The video below demonstrates the process.

  1. Log in to canvas.bowdoin.edu with your Bowdoin username and password.
  2. Select your account picture in the top left of your Canvas page.
  3. From the list of options that appears, select NameCoach.
  4. Select Record Name.
  5. Use one of the three options to record your name: Phone, Web Recorder, or Uploader.
  6. Select Submit and Finish.
